Метод mktime модуля time - преобразование строки с датой и временем в секунды на Python

Метод mktime модуля time преобразует строку с датой и временем в секунды. В параметре метода указываем структуру времени struct_time или кортеж из 9 элементов с обязательным флагом dst, который отображает локальное время.

Синтаксис

import time time.mktime(структура времени или кортеж)

Пример

Давайте преобразуем строку с датой и временем в секунды:

import time struct_time = time.strptime('10/10/2020 10:15', '%d/%m/%Y %H:%M') res = time.mktime(struct_time) print(res)

Результат выполненного кода:

1602314100.0

Смотрите также

  • метод time модуля time,
    который возвращает время в секундах с начала эпохи
  • метод ctime модуля time,
    который преобразует секунды в строку с датой и временем
  • метод localtime модуля time,
    который преобразует секунды в локальное время
  • метод gmtime модуля time,
    который преобразует секунды в формат UTC
  • метод sleep модуля time,
    который останавливает выполнение операции на указанное количество секунд



Чат с GPT Компилятор